With the deadline fast approaching, former iTools users who have yet to subscribe to .Mac for the introductory price of $49.95 are receiving emails from The Mothership. Here it is in its entirety:
Dear .Mac trial member,
Your .Mac account will expire on September 30, 2002. If you don’t sign up ( https://www.mac.com/WebObjects/Signup.woa/wa/upgrade?aff=consumer&cty=US&lang=en ) for full membership, which you can still do at the special former iTools member price of US$49.95, that is the last day you’ll be able access your Mac.com Email account, home pages and iDisk.
We hope you won’t let that happen. .Mac comes with improved versions of what was already great about iTools, like first-rate, web-accessible, ISP-independent Mac.com Email, and tight integration between iPhoto and HomePage publishing. It also delivers important new features like McAfee’s Virex virus protection software, Backup software from Apple, and calendar publishing from iCal. And continual improvement is built into its DNA.
The future of power and convenience through connected computing is bright, and .Mac is leading the way–just ask the more than 100,000 members who’ve already signed up. At only US$49.95 for the first year, the price is amazingly low and the value of the benefits is already remarkably high and heading higher.
